Got these today.

Final shackle angle and bump stops and shocks installed. Shackle angle ended up a few degrees from where i wanted, but i honestly think it will be just fine. We had 48* on mock up... but ended with 38* cause we both apparently missed that it wasn't 100% sitting on its own weight... oops... the shackles are 6" long currently. A little longer shackle will change the shackle angle, but will also point the pinion down a little more than I want. I ordered shims to angle it up a little to help when the axle droops out to keep from binding the u-joint

1.) Got the knuckle on there trying to get it mocked up.

2.) For anyone wondering, stock H1 wheels will not clear on a SRW front axle.

3.) They hit the stock tie rod location.

4.) And wont even touch the lugs.
ForumRunner_20121007_164604.webp
ForumRunner_20121007_164655.webp
ForumRunner_20121007_164707.webp
ForumRunner_20121007_164719.webp
 
Put it all together to try and figure out what to do for wheels and get some measurements. It has been clearanced for 15's but not the 4.25" bs wheels i currently run out back. I think a 3" bs will clear but decided on a 2.75" backspace for good measure. I am planning on 42's with recentered H1's, but i just can't do it right now. I already have over $4k in this front axle and haven't ordered my full hydro from PSC yet. (Speaking of, anyone know an adapter for a saginaw onto stock 2f? Or what PSC kit i need? I know it is an 8x2.5" single ended ram.) So gonna make my current tires work.

With the axle width and the wheel width and backspacing i am looking at being 84" wide. Gonna be pretty nice! Axle is 69.5" wheels will be a 15x10 in an 8x6.5 bolt pattern with 2.75" backspacing. I will also be purchasing some DIY Beadlocks so i wont have to worry about loosing a bead when i am beating on it at a bad angle with wheel cut or whatever have ya.
